not suitable for homeschool but get as supplemental workbook,
This review is from: First Grade Big Workbook! (Ages 6-7) (Perfect Paperback)
If you were intending to use this workbook as a homeschool curriculum you will be disappointed. If your child doesn't have background knowledge such as an understanding of historical occurrences such as the pilgrim voyage than they will be lost on some pages. The workbook provides a few sentences of background info on some topics such as mammals but it is obviously meant to expand current knowledge and not provide the lesson itself. Another `flaw' is that these workbooks tend to be 1 grade or more behind. I recommend buying one a grade or two above the level at which your child works.

Not thorough enough for homeschoolers.,
By
This review is from: First Grade Big Workbook! (Ages 6-7) (Perfect Paperback)
This book is probably good summer activities to reinforce what kids have learned during the school year, but there is a big gap between what is taught in the BIG Kindergarten and the BIG First Grade. I wouldn't use this book as an exclusive curriculum--it is not intended for that, I guess. The phonics does not slowly build from one skill to the next; it is just two pages about silent e, two pages about long a, etc. Same with all the subjects... much too brief to be used as a curriculum. I use this book just to tear out a fun page about a topic my daughter already knows.
